Norwegian Viva is the newer ship in this comparison. Built in 2023, it is 6 years newer than Norwegian Joy, which entered service in 2017. Norwegian Joy is approximately 17% larger by gross tonnage at 167,725 GT. Norwegian Joy also carries 685 more passengers. Norwegian Joy has upcoming sailings in Alaska, while Norwegian Viva has sailings in Greek Isles. Based on the upcoming cruises currently displayed, Norwegian Joy has the lower average starting price per day. The sailings shown cover different itineraries, so the price per day figures are not a like-for-like comparison. Cruise fares vary significantly by itinerary, departure date and cabin availability, so any price difference should be treated as a snapshot rather than a permanent gap.

Norwegian Viva was built in 2023, making it 6 years newer than Norwegian Joy, which was built in 2017.
At 167,725 GT, Norwegian Joy is approximately 17% larger by gross tonnage than Norwegian Viva at 143,535 GT.
Norwegian Joy carries up to 3,900 passengers compared with 3,215 aboard Norwegian Viva, a difference of 685 passengers.
Norwegian Viva offers more space per passenger: 44.6 GT per guest, compared with 43 aboard Norwegian Joy. A higher passenger space ratio generally means less crowding in public areas.
